Production Co-ordinator @ IMG Studios


 

IMG are looking for a Production Coordinator to join a brand new team which is being set up to produce a new football production. The successful candidate will report to the Production Manager and will provide key production co-ordination and assistance to the Production Manager and Producer of the football related production.

 

Contract type: Fixed term (July 2018 – May 2019)

Location: London – Stockley Park

Salary: Competitive

 

This is a great opportunity to be involved at the inception of a new team and the beginning of a new production. Key responsibilities will include booking voiceovers, editors and all post production facilities; ensuring Risk Assessments are properly created by the relevant Producer; creating Call sheets and being point of contact for crew out of office hours and booking talent and arranging travel arrangements.

 

The ideal candidate will have a previous experience as established Production Assistant; experience of complex staff scheduling; experience of cost tracking and producing small production budgets and experience of raising electronic purchase orders, floats, producing call sheets and Microsoft Word, Excel, Powerpoint and SAP knowledge.
